Worship Services

At St. Paul's we offer several worship services  to meet the varied schedule and worship needs in our community.  Each service has its own character yet remains firmly within the tradition of the Episcopal Church. 

  • SATURDAY - 5:00 P.M.  /  SUNDAY - 10:15 A.M. 

    HOLY EUCHARIST

    Our worship is characterized by worship that reflects the liturgical season, honors Creation, and invites us to the work of love. 


    The Saturday evening 5:00 p.m. service is simple and informal.

                            Taize´Worship on the first Saturday of each month at 5:00 p.m. This deeply contemplative worship includes chant, prayers, readings, and silence. 


    The Sunday service at 10:15 a.m. includes beautiful music. In addition to congregational hymn-singing, this service includes the choir, frequent soloists, and strings. Child care is available in the nursery for this service; kids 4 and up are invited to attend Sunday School. Children join the adults in church when it's time for Communion. 


    After church, please join in the lively, warm conversations on the patio. We want to know you better. 


    The Thursday noon service is intimate and quiet, using the Book of Common Prayer Rite II.
